## Releases & Canary Gating

Quick rules for the Lanternjaw canary, mostly for whoever's on call:

- Canary gets 5% of traffic for 2 hours minimum.
- Error rate above 0.4% auto-rolls back — don't fight it.
- Manual promotion needs a signed release manifest, no exceptions.
- If the Pinwheel gate stalls, re-sign and re-push rather than force-merging.

To sign the manifest, use the release key shown here.

signing key of bagap-yawep = bky13_TbfT6ZMUoGJo2

Future maintainers should know that the matcher's candidate cache historically triggered stop-the-world pauses exceeding 400ms under peak load, which caused match timeouts downstream. This release moves the cache off-heap and tunes the young-generation sizing. Verify by replaying the Lindmere peak-traffic capture for thirty minutes and confirming p99 pause time stays under 50ms. Do not ship if any single pause exceeds 150ms. Record the soak-test build token directly under this item.

session token of fahap-hawip = htk31_7852f2b3276dba2738f98fa97f92237

## Ticket: Tile cache config drift in Mapfen renderer

During review of the latest Mapfen deploy, we found the tile-rendering cache in the east cluster diverged from the canonical manifest: eviction thresholds and warm-fill concurrency were hand-edited in October and never committed. This explains the inconsistent cache-hit ratios flagged last sprint. Please compare the change set against the cluster's current live values, reproduced below.

service settings:
[casax]
port = 6379
team = rusir
host = casax.zemvarhq.corp
region = outer-4
access_code = ac_9808ce
timeout_ms = 1500